Tubing and Rubber Goods
Check hoses and reservoir bag for tears, cracks, holes, etc. List damaged items on test sheet.

Small leaks will not require immediate replacement although user will need to be aware of the possibility of increased N2O in the room during a procedure. Certification can take place and damaged items can be replaced in field at a later date.
With gas supply connected and unit off, soap outspout. It is located on the front of PC, DCs, and portable digitals. It is located on bagtees plugged into remote outlets for CMs and Digitals.
Leaks through the outspout with units off, indicate internal leaks that must be fixed at Accutron.
With gas supply connected and unit off, soap resuscitator fitting. This will be labeled O2 or O2 Resuscitator. It is located on the front of CMs and portable Digitals, on the back or side of PCs and DCs, and on the remote outlet block for CM digitals. These leaks must be returned to Accutron for repair.

With gas supply connected and unit flowing 4 lpm of each gas, soap override in two places. (PC/DC only) test all joints where individual blocks join. Leaking units should be returned to Accutron for repair.
PC/DCs only. With gas supply connected and unit flowing 4 lpm of each gas, soap top and bottom of flow tubes. Leaking units should be returned to Accutron for repair.
Replace non-rebreathing (outspout) leaf :
To replace leaf: remove screw with Allen wrench, replace leaf on screw, reinstall into outspout.
5 Hole Leaf: PN 27392 (.50")

Test Fixture Setup
8
SLPM
Attach battery pack to the fixture. Use small switch on battery pack to turn fixture ON and OFF. When fixture is ON make sure it shows "Mass SLPM" or just SLPM on the right side of flow reading. If it does not, press button next to Mass or SLPM to change to Mass SLPM. See last page for gas selection procedure. Slightly push one end of white hose from kit onto barb fitting on left of fixture. Slightly push the other end of white hose ovet the barb fitting threaed togerher with plastic fitting. When testing customer units, plug this plastic fitting into outspout. Outspout is located on front of PC/DC and on bagtees for all others.

Oxygen Flush
Plug downspout with the urethane plug provided.
Select O2 gas on fixture (see Step 20) and connect outspout connector from fixture to outspout. (Note: outspout is built into PC and DC. All other units will be located on remote outlet bagtee.) Press Flush button on all standard units. Digitals, turn unit on and press Green Flush button.
All units: verify that fixture reading is 20 SLPM or more.

Failsafe Test
Ball style: Turn on flow of each gas to 4 LPM. Digital: Turn on and set Total Flow to 8.0 and %N2O to 50.
The failsafe test is critical!
Shut oxygen supply at source, i.e. oxygen tanks. Wait while oxygen pressure drops in system. This may take several minutes for large office with many outlets.
Remove from service immediately if it fails. Send units to Accutron for repair. Call Accutron Customer Service for return authorization number. 1-800-531-2221
Verify all flow stops and fixture reading shows no flow . Verify that digital also gives Failure Oxygen alarm. Restore oxygen flow when Failsafe test is complete.

% N2O Control Ball Style Flowmeters only
15
P1021 rev02
Select Mix5050 gas on fixture.
O2 - 6 lpm and N2O - 6 lpm. Verify fixture reading is 12 ± 0.5 lpm.
Select Mix70/30 gas on fixture
Total Flow 9.9 lpm and %N2O at 70. Verify fixture is 9.9±0.5 lpm.
With flow still set per previous step (6 lpm O2 and 6 lpm N2O), check reading on %N2O knobs. Unit passes if pointer touches any part of the printed "50%" characters. For units with windows, unit passes as long as the printed "50%" is within the window. Characters do not have to be centered on pointer or in window.
Note: The percentage nitrous control is offered as a convenience only by allowing simple adjustment to general flow areas. It is not meant to be perfect, and has no affect on flow tube accuracy, although it might be an indicator of overall performance. Safe and effective conscious sedation can be achieved, even if percentage control is off, by using the calibrated flow tubes and conversion table in Users Manual. User can opt to use flowmeter if percentage control is off by signing the report accepting this as is.
Digital percentage control is accurate at all flows and is monitored by mass flow sensors and microprocessors. Nothing to test in this step.

Oxygen Resuscitator Flow
18
Resuscitator is on back or side of PC/DCs, on front of CMs and portable digitals, and on bagtee blocks for CM Digitals. Detach outspout connector from white hose and attach quick (angled) connector. Select O2 gas on fixture. Plug quick connector attached to white hose into resuscitator fitting for only a moment. Gas will rush out at high flow. Verify fixture reading is 100 lpm or more.

Final paperwork and Equipment Labeling
Complete Test Form (F1224) and have customer sign where appropriate. Make copy and give Original to customer. Fill out certification Label (27523) and attach to back of flowmeter. Add two years to current date for Due date. Fill out Certificate of Performance (F1226) and give to customer. NOTES: 1) PDF files of F1224 and F1226 are available at www.accutron-inc.com for printing new forms in the field. 2) Certification labels (27523) must be purchased from Acccutron

Gas Selection Procedure
Step3
1. Press button next to "MENU". 2. Press button next to "GAS SELECT". 3. Use "LN-UP" OR "LN-DN" buttons to select gas. 4. Press button next to "SET". 5. Press button next to "MAIN". Note: Since buttons can be arranged differently then shown, it is very important to follow what "Next to" button to press instead of going by button location. Step1
